AX55 FDJ is a 2006 Renault Kangoo in Grey with a 1,598c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 23 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 69.6%.
Across all 2006 Renault Kangoo models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.0% with a typical mileage of 76,523 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Renault Kangoo f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 86,705 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AX55 FDJ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Renault Kangoo typ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 20 years old, this Renault Kangoo is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
